Output e8d67348fcdabdfa72a5b3fe0a2a5f18fb91ff44f57a8ba2d52ce2a4b47ff3da:0

value
31276827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b974006e4e192a1f82cd654270278f3210766c3 OP_EQUAL
address
3A3Jc3P6NsZCogqnW7pukUaBLDhdbD9BLk
transaction
e8d67348fcdabdfa72a5b3fe0a2a5f18fb91ff44f57a8ba2d52ce2a4b47ff3da
confirmations
313508
spent
true